Thrifty Ways to Update Your Wardrobe

Revamp what you already own

One of the most budget-friendly ways to update your wardrobe is by reimagining and restyling the clothes you already have. Try experimenting with different combinations and layering, mix and matching different pieces to create new outfits. You’ll be surprised at how many new looks you can create without spending a dime!

Thrift store treasures

Thrift stores are a goldmine for finding unique and affordable pieces to add to your wardrobe. Take some time to browse through the racks and see what catches your eye. You can find everything from vintage blouses to designer jeans, often at a fraction of the original price. Thrift shopping is not only budget-friendly but also an eco-friendly way to update your wardrobe.

DIY alterations

If you have basic sewing skills, consider altering your existing clothing to give them a fresh and updated look. You can hem a pair of wide-leg trousers to create a trendy cropped silhouette, or take in the waist of a dress for a more flattering fit. DIY alterations can breathe new life into old pieces and save you money on buying new items.

Clothing swap with friends

Organize a clothing swap with your friends to refresh your wardrobe without spending any money. Gather together garments that you no longer wear but are still in good condition, and invite your friends to do the same. This way, you can refresh your wardrobe with “new” pieces while also spending quality time with friends.

Invest in classic pieces

When you do decide to invest in new clothing, opt for timeless and versatile pieces that will stand the test of time. Classic items like a tailored blazer, a little black dress, or a quality pair of jeans can be mixed and matched in countless ways, making them a worthy investment for your wardrobe. Focus on quality over quantity to build a wardrobe that lasts.
